Solar System DiscoNayutan Seijin

It makes you want to raise your fist and sing along.
It’s a catchy and satisfying Vocaloid dance-rock track.
Created by NayutalieN, a Vocaloid producer from outer space, it was released in 2017.
It’s included on the second album “Object Y from Planet Nayuta” and the compilation album “Don’t-You Music.” Even if you’re hearing it for the first time, the melody feels familiar.
NayutalieN’s sense of style is astonishing.
Crank up your energy with this song and head into summer!
Together until it clears upKasamura Tōta

This is a gentle Vocaloid song that softly stays close to a wounded heart and speaks of waiting together for a brighter future.
The piece, graced by beautiful piano melodies, is a track by Vocaloid producer Tota Kasamura, released in June 2025.
Featuring Amaginu as the vocalist, its lyrics carry a warm message that gently gives you a push forward.
When your heart is tired or you’re longing for someone’s kindness, listening to it will surely bring you comfort.
I hate the June rain.hiruneko

This is a song by hiruneko, woven with Hatsune Miku’s transparent vocals to capture feelings that seem to melt into the long rains of the rainy season.
Released in 2018, the piece expresses the gloom and loneliness we feel on damp, rainy days with a light, upbeat sound.
The stylish blend of piano rock and synth draws you in.
It carries the dampness of rain yet somehow feels refreshing.
Since it’s themed around a “rain woman,” those who feel they fit that description might find it relatable.
I want to bathe in the rain.Mushipi

A piece woven from fusion and waltz, full of a stylish yet bittersweet atmosphere.
A track released in July 2015 that shines with Mushipi’s signature delicate musicality.
It depicts the heart being purified by the falling rain, harmonizing beautifully with a sound that carries a touch of jazz.
As you keep listening, you feel more and more at peace.
How about taking it along for a stroll under an umbrella on a rainy day?
Rain and SodaAoigi Gou

How about a bittersweet rock tune? This piece was created by Gou Aoiki, also known as Gogo Afternoon Tea, with an Otomachi Una version released on Niconico in September 2021 and a version sung by Minamo published on YouTube.
The lyrics, which liken the loneliness of parting to rain and the fizz of soda, are striking, and together with the sound, they squeeze your heart.
And yet, somehow, when it’s over, you’re left feeling as if a refreshing breeze has washed over you.
It might be perfect for looking back on summer memories.
See the happiness.you-man

It’s a moving piece that begins with the gentle sound of rain.
Composed by Youman and released in November 2023, it drew attention as an entry in “Mushoku Toumei-sai II.” GUMI’s soft vocals melt into the delicate piano melody.
The combination of lyrics that portray finding hope in the scenery after the rain stops and the beautiful tones evokes a cleansing, heartwarming emotion.
It’s a healing track recommended for moments of calm or when you’re feeling worn out.

Rain is a prison sentence.Sohbana

A stylish rock number driven by a funky bassline.
It’s a track by Vocaloid producer Sohbana, also known for works like “I’m Really Fine,” released in 2022.
It participated in the BOCALOID Collection Spring 2022 TOP 100 rankings.
Centered on a crisp, hard-edged band sound, the sharp sonic textures unfold and pair perfectly with Miku’s poised vocals.
The lyrics explore the loneliness felt while being caught in the rain.
Phrases that incorporate hip-hop elements also leave a strong impression.
